Short answer
Confirm emergency contacts, radio or satellite backup, check-in procedures and who coordinates help when mobile networks are unavailable.

Rusizi National Park planning context
Rusizi is a wetland and river-edge destination close to Bujumbura. Water conditions, boat arrangements, access permissions and the timing of wildlife activity should be verified.
Access, seasonal operations, activity rules and nearby services can change, so destination-specific confirmation matters.
